How to travel from Legian to Semarang, Indonesia

The distance between Legian and Semarang is around 576km (358 miles) and the quickest way to get there is to fly which takes around 1h 55m.

Frequently asked questionsabout travel between Legian and Semarang

There are several options for getting from Legian to Semarang by plane, bus, ferry, train and car. The cheapest option is to take the bus which costs around IDR 524,230 ($35) and will take around 15h 40m. If you need to get there more quickly, you can fly and arrive in approximately 1h 55m, though it is a bit more costly at approximately IDR 2,561,230 ($170).

The distance between Legian and Semarang is around 576km (358 miles). In a direct line (as the crow flies), the distance is 556km (346 miles)

It takes around 1h 55m to get from Legian and Semarang by plane.

The quickest way to get from Legian to Semarang is to fly which takes around 1h 55m and will set you back approx IDR 2,561,230 ($170).

The cheapest way to travel between Legian and Semarang is to take the bus which will typically cost around IDR 524,230 ($35) for a standard one-way ticket.

Bus travel

Yes there is a bus that runs regularly from Legian and Semarang. It typically takes around 15h 40m and departs once daily.

There are no direct bus services that runs from Legian to Semarang. However, you can instead can take several connecting buses with changeovers in Banyuwangi. These services run once daily and will take a minimum of 15h 40m.

LADJU Trans, Damri, Mtrans and Nusantara run regular bus services between Legian and Semarang. Buses run once daily and take around 15h 40m on average but will vary depending on you book with.

Flights and Airlines

Yes you can fly from Legian and Semarang. Flights depart from Ngurah Rai (DPS) and arrive at Ahmad Yani (SRG). The flight takes around 1h 40m.

Yes there is a direct flight between Legian and Semarang with no stop-overs required. Flights typically take around 1h 40m.

Wings Air, Citilink Indonesia, Lion Mentari Airlines, Garuda Indonesia and Batik Air fly between Legian and Semarang. Flights depart from Ngurah Rai (DPS) and and arrive into Ahmad Yani (SRG). These flights usually take around 1h 40m.

The flight from Legian to Semarang typically takes around 1h 40m. Flights depart from Ngurah Rai (DPS) and and arrive into Ahmad Yani (SRG).

The closest major airport to Semarang is Achmad Yani International Airport (SRG) (SRG) which is approximately 5km (3 miles) from Semarang. Adisumarmo International Airport (SOC) (SOC) and Adisucipto Airport (JOG) (JOG) are also nearby and might be a better alternative airport depending on where you are flying from.
